PRODUCT INTRODUCTION
description
ML228 is a member of the class of 1,2,4-triazines in which the triazine ring is substituted at positions 3, 5, and 6 by pyridin-2-yl, ([biphenyl]-4-ylmethyl)amin, and methyl groups, respectively. It is an activator of the hypoxia inducible factor (HIF) pathway. It has a role as a hypoxia-inducible factor pathway activator. It is a member of biphenyls, a member of 1,2,4-triazines, a secondary amino compound and a member of pyridines.
